Average Wiring Upgrade Costs by Home Size
Assumptions: Midwest labor rates, standard Romex wiring, typical 100-amp service replacement, normal access.
The average cost for a full electrical rewiring scales with home size and service level. A small, older home (under 1,200 sq ft) often lands in the $6,000-$12,000 range, while mid-size homes (1,200-2,000 sq ft) commonly run $12,000-$22,000. Larger homes (over 2,000 sq ft) frequently reach $20,000-$40,000 or more, especially if a panel upgrade, ground-fault protection, and multiple circuits are added.
Key takeaway: Expect per-square-foot pricing to be lower for smaller homes and higher for larger homes due to extended labor and more material runs.
Major Cost Components in an Electrical Rewire Project
Assumptions: Suburban site, standard materials, no custom finishes, and a single property to service.
Cost is driven by four to six components: materials, labor, panel work, permits, disposal, and warranty if offered. The following table shows typical allocations, with ranges to reflect regional differences and job scope.
| Component | Low | Average | High | Notes |
|---|---|---|---|---|
| Materials (wiring, breakers, boxes) | $2,000 | $4,500 | $10,000 | Includes conduit and accessories |
| Labor | $4,000 | $7,000 | $22,000 | Typically 2- to 3-person crew over several days |
| Panel upgrade | $1,000 | $2,500 | $4,500 | Optional if service level changes |
| Permits & inspections | $150 | $600 | $2,000 | varies by city |
| Delivery/Disposal | $100 | $400 | $1,000 | Old wiring and materials removal |
| Warranty/Misc | $100 | $500 | $2,000 | Limited coverage often included |

Key Variables That Drive the Final Quote
Assumptions: Typical 100-amp to 200-amp service upgrades, standard home layout.
Two numeric thresholds commonly shift price substantially: (1) square footage and (2) service upgrade level (amps) required. Hereditary wiring age or the need to replace old metal conduit can push costs up by 20-40% in some markets. Additional drivers include:
- Number of circuits and outlets to replace
- Panel type and proximity to service drop
- Accessibility of walls and ceilings for wiring runs
- Presence of historical wiring or code-improvement requirements
- Regional labor rate dispersion and permit costs
Smart-home prep and upgraded safety features can add 10-25% to the project if included, such as AFCI/GFCI protection and dedicated circuits for high-draw appliances.
Practical Ways to Reduce Electrical Rewiring Costs
Assumptions: Budget-minded homeowner with standard scope and normal access.
Price can be controlled by narrowing scope, choosing service options, and planning timing. Practical moves include:
- Limit scope to essential rewiring now and defer non-critical upgrades
- Bundle related electrical work (lighting, outlets, and switches) in one project
- Choose standard materials over premium finishes
- Schedule work during off-peak seasons to reduce labor rates
- Request quotes that separate materials and labor for easy comparison
Planning in advance often saves money by avoiding last-minute changes.
Regional Price Variations for Rewiring Projects
Assumptions: U.S. regional cost spread reflects typical urban, suburban, and rural markets.
Prices differ by region due to labor rates, permit costs, and material availability. On average, urban areas may see +15% to +30% higher pricing than rural areas, while coastal markets can be 5% to 20% higher than inland regions. A small-town project might be at the lower end, while a large metro with complex access can push toward the high end.
When comparing bids, ask for the same scope to avoid misreading regional deltas.
Per-Unit Pricing Details for Materials and Labor
Assumptions: Typical residential rewiring with standard 12/2 and 14/2 NM cable, modest panel work.
Pricing often appears as per-unit costs for devices, outlets, and runs, plus a lump sum for labor. Examples:
- Outlets and switches wired: $130-$260 per device
- New outlets with AFCI/GFCI: $180-$320 per location
- Conduit runs: $4-$12 per linear foot depending on material
- Panel upgrade labor: part of project, often $1,000-$2,500 on top of panel and breakers
Understanding per-unit costs helps refine a bid and catch itemized overages.
Labor Hours, Crew Size, and Scheduling Impacts
Assumptions: Midwestern city, standard two- to three-bedroom single-family home.
Labor cost scales with crew size and project duration. A typical rewiring job may need 2-3 electricians for 4-7 days, depending on wall access and existing wiring. Example ranges:
- Labor hours: 40-120 hours total
- Crew size: 2-3 electricians
- Hourly rate: $55-$85 per hour per electrician
Delays due to access issues or inspections can add days and raise total labor costs.
Permits, Inspections, and Code Upgrades Impacting Total
Assumptions: City permitting is required for new circuits and service upgrades.
Permits and inspections commonly add $150-$2,000 to the total, with higher sums for significant panel upgrades or service changes. Regional code upgrades (arc-fault protection, tamper-resistant outlets) can add cost but improve safety and future resale value.
Always budget for permit-related contingencies to avoid project stoppages.
